Installs, maintains, and repairs machinery, equipment, or software directly at customer locations. Acting as the primary in-person representative, they diagnose technical issues, perform on-site troubleshooting, and ensure optimal performance. The role requires strong technical knowledge, manual dexterity, and, often, a valid driver's license for travel to various sites.
Core Responsibilities
- Installation & Setup: Assembling and configuring new equipment at client sites.
- Troubleshooting & Repair: Diagnosing technical malfunctions, repairing equipment, and replacing broken components.
- Preventative Maintenance: Conducting scheduled checks to ensure optimal, long-term equipment function.
- Customer Support: Educating clients on equipment operation, addressing queries, and fostering positive relationships.
- Documentation: Generating detailed, timely service reports, maintaining records, and tracking inventory/parts.
- Safety Compliance: Adhering to all safety protocols and regulations on-site. Indeed
Key Skills & Qualifications
- Technical Knowledge: Proficiency in electrical, mechanical, or software systems (varies by industry).
- Problem-Solving: Strong analytical skills to diagnose issues efficiently.
- Communication: Clear, professional, and empathetic interaction with clients.
- Time Management: Organizing travel and managing multiple service calls effectively.
- Physical Stamina: Ability to lift heavy equipment, climb, or work in confined spaces.
- Technology Utilization: Experience with field service software, mobile apps, and GPS.
